CMS 3D CMS Logo

PFDisplacedVertexProducer.h
Go to the documentation of this file.
1 #ifndef RecoParticleFlow_PFTracking_PFDisplacedVertexProducer_h_
2 #define RecoParticleFlow_PFTracking_PFDisplacedVertexProducer_h_
3 
4 // user include files
8 
11 
13 
26 public:
28 
29  ~PFDisplacedVertexProducer() override;
30 
31  void produce(edm::Event&, const edm::EventSetup&) override;
32 
33 private:
37 
39 
42 
44  bool verbose_;
45 
48 };
49 
50 #endif
PFDisplacedVertexProducer::produce
void produce(edm::Event &, const edm::EventSetup &) override
Definition: PFDisplacedVertexProducer.cc:88
PFDisplacedVertexProducer
Producer for DisplacedVertices.
Definition: PFDisplacedVertexProducer.h:25
edm::EDGetTokenT< reco::PFDisplacedVertexCandidateCollection >
PFDisplacedVertexProducer::inputTagMainVertex_
edm::EDGetTokenT< reco::VertexCollection > inputTagMainVertex_
Input tag for main vertex to cut of dxy of secondary tracks.
Definition: PFDisplacedVertexProducer.h:40
EDProducer.h
PFDisplacedVertexProducer::inputTagBeamSpot_
edm::EDGetTokenT< reco::BeamSpot > inputTagBeamSpot_
Definition: PFDisplacedVertexProducer.h:41
PFDisplacedVertexProducer::inputTagVertexCandidates_
edm::EDGetTokenT< reco::PFDisplacedVertexCandidateCollection > inputTagVertexCandidates_
Definition: PFDisplacedVertexProducer.h:36
MakerMacros.h
PFDisplacedVertexFinder
Definition: PFDisplacedVertexFinder.h:31
edm::ParameterSet
Definition: ParameterSet.h:36
Event.h
PFDisplacedVertexProducer::~PFDisplacedVertexProducer
~PFDisplacedVertexProducer() override
Definition: PFDisplacedVertexProducer.cc:86
edm::stream::EDProducer
Definition: EDProducer.h:38
PFDisplacedVertexProducer::pfDisplacedVertexFinder_
PFDisplacedVertexFinder pfDisplacedVertexFinder_
Displaced Vertices finder.
Definition: PFDisplacedVertexProducer.h:47
edm::EventSetup
Definition: EventSetup.h:57
PFDisplacedVertexProducer::PFDisplacedVertexProducer
PFDisplacedVertexProducer(const edm::ParameterSet &)
Definition: PFDisplacedVertexProducer.cc:27
Frameworkfwd.h
PFDisplacedVertexProducer::verbose_
bool verbose_
verbose ?
Definition: PFDisplacedVertexProducer.h:44
ParameterSet.h
edm::Event
Definition: Event.h:73
PFDisplacedVertexFinder.h